What you’ll be doing
As Head of Talent and People Solutions, you\'ll be accountable for the quality, performance, reputation and commercial success of Fitzgerald\'s Talent and Culture service.
This is a senior, hands-on leadership role. You\'ll balance strategic ownership of the function with leading complex client work, developing specialist capability, and delivering commercially sound, values-led outcomes for clients.
You\'ll lead and grow our Talent and Culture service, bringing together talent strategy, resourcing, reward, learning and organisational development, and people technology to help clients solve complex people and business challenges.
You\'ll work closely with our People Services Director (Specialist Expertise) and partner seamlessly with Employee Relations and People Partnering colleagues — ensuring clients receive joined-up, practical and impactful people solutions.
This is a role where leadership, commercial awareness and good judgement really matter. You\'ll bring clarity, direction and momentum to a growing service area while staying close enough to delivery to ensure clients receive an exceptional experience.

About you
You’re a commercially minded people leader who combines specialist expertise with a broad understanding of how talent, culture and people solutions come together to help organisations succeed.
You'll bring:
* Significant experience leading and delivering work in at least one specialist area such as learning and organisational development, reward, talent or people technology
* Broad understanding of how specialist people solutions connect together to solve wider business challenges
* Experience operating in a commercially accountable, client-facing leadership role
* Experience growing services, revenue or client solutions within a consultancy or professional services environment
* Confidence leading senior client relationships and influencing at Executive or Board level
* Experience building or managing associate, contractor or specialist delivery models
* Strong commercial acumen, including scoping, pricing and delivering profitable work
* Experience balancing strategic leadership with hands-on delivery
You\'ll also be:
* A clear, credible and engaging communicator
* Commercially aware and solutions-focused
* Calm under pressure and comfortable navigating ambiguity
* Organised, detail-focused and able to manage multiple priorities
* Collaborative, low-ego and invested in developing others
* Curious, adaptable and open to learning
CIPD Level 7, an OD/HR qualification, or equivalent experience is also desirable.
You'll need to hold a UK driving licence and be happy to travel occasionally as part of the role.
